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/36.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Css 导航栏和标题之间令人讨厌的空格_Css_Html_Twitter Bootstrap - Fatal编程技术网

Css 导航栏和标题之间令人讨厌的空格

Css 导航栏和标题之间令人讨厌的空格,css,html,twitter-bootstrap,Css,Html,Twitter Bootstrap,我在导航栏和页面顶部的标题之间有一个恼人的空格,我似乎无法摆脱。我已经尝试了.navbar{margin-bottom:0;}和section#title-bar{margin-top:0;}。但是,差距并没有消失。我用的是bootstrap4 这是我的密码: 正文{ 背景:#FFF; 填充顶部:4rem;} 身体,导航栏{ 页边距底部:0px;} 正文.绿色文本{ 颜色:#1CAA98!重要;} body,jumbotron{ 背景:url(../img/site\u showcase\u

我在导航栏和页面顶部的
标题之间有一个恼人的空格,我似乎无法摆脱。我已经尝试了
.navbar{margin-bottom:0;}
section#title-bar{margin-top:0;}
。但是,差距并没有消失。我用的是bootstrap4

这是我的密码:

正文{
背景:#FFF;
填充顶部:4rem;}
身体,导航栏{
页边距底部:0px;}
正文.绿色文本{
颜色:#1CAA98!重要;}
body,jumbotron{
背景:url(../img/site\u showcase\u bg.jpg)没有重复的顶部中心;
颜色:#FFF;
高度:500px;
溢出:无;}
body.jumbotron img.app-btn{
宽度:40%;
右边距:30px;
显示:内联;}
身体,大毒枭h1{
页边距顶部:60px;}
body.jumbotron p{
页边距底部:40px;}
body.jumbotron img.showCase-img{
最大宽度:100%;}
主体部分#中间{
填充:10px 0 40px 0;}
车身部分#中间img.demo-1{
宽度:100%;
填充:3倍;
边框:1px实心#CCC;}
车身部分#中间img.demo-2{
宽度:100%;
填充:3倍;
边框:1px实心#CCC;}
车身部分#中间img.demo-3{
宽度:100%;
填充:3倍;
边框:1px实心#CCC;}
主体部分#特征{
背景:#1CAA98;
颜色:#FFF;
填充:40px;
溢出:自动;}
车身部分#特征ul li{
字体大小:22px;
列表样式:无;}
车身部分#特征。大徽标{
宽度:100%;}
正文部分#标题栏{
高度:80px;
背景:#1CAA98;
颜色:#FFF;
填充:0;
边距:0;}
正文页脚{
背景:#333;
颜色:#FFF;
填充:30px 0 20px 0;}
体尾李{
浮动:左;
填充:0 10px 0 10px;
列表样式:无;}
正文页脚a{
颜色:#FFF;}
正文页脚p{
浮动:右;}

伽玛:关于
关于伽马
这是由于
填充顶部:4em
主体上,您需要使用
56px
(导航栏的高度),例如:

body {
  padding-top: 56px; // Height of the navbar
}
请看下面的代码片段:

正文{
背景:#FFF;
填充顶部:56px;}
身体,导航栏{
页边距底部:0px;}
正文.绿色文本{
颜色:#1CAA98!重要;}
body,jumbotron{
背景:url(../img/site\u showcase\u bg.jpg)没有重复的顶部中心;
颜色:#FFF;
高度:500px;
溢出:无;}
body.jumbotron img.app-btn{
宽度:40%;
右边距:30px;
显示:内联;}
身体,大毒枭h1{
页边距顶部:60px;}
body.jumbotron p{
页边距底部:40px;}
body.jumbotron img.showCase-img{
最大宽度:100%;}
主体部分#中间{
填充:10px 0 40px 0;}
车身部分#中间img.demo-1{
宽度:100%;
填充:3倍;
边框:1px实心#CCC;}
车身部分#中间img.demo-2{
宽度:100%;
填充:3倍;
边框:1px实心#CCC;}
车身部分#中间img.demo-3{
宽度:100%;
填充:3倍;
边框:1px实心#CCC;}
主体部分#特征{
背景:#1CAA98;
颜色:#FFF;
填充:40px;
溢出:自动;}
车身部分#特征ul li{
字体大小:22px;
列表样式:无;}
车身部分#特征。大徽标{
宽度:100%;}
正文部分#标题栏{
高度:80px;
背景:#1CAA98;
颜色:#FFF;
填充:0;
边距:0;}
正文页脚{
背景:#333;
颜色:#FFF;
填充:30px 0 20px 0;}
体尾李{
浮动:左;
填充:0 10px 0 10px;
列表样式:无;}
正文页脚a{
颜色:#FFF;}
正文页脚p{
浮动:右;}

伽玛:关于
关于伽马
您需要从
h1
标记本身中删除上页边距,并从导航栏导航
ul
列表中删除下页边距,默认情况下浏览器样式就是这样